24小时热门版块排行榜    

查看: 1592  |  回复: 0

zhuce9

铜虫 (小有名气)

[求助] 【难题?】ansys不用其它前处理软件,仅用lesize命令划分线段

我是查过了theory reference,command reference,modeling and mesh guide ,在网上搜了好几天也没找到,才来问这个问题的。不知道能不能在这儿解决这个问题。
我知道在一些前处理软件里这么做很简单。
LESIZE,NL1,SIZE,ANGSIZ,NDIV,SPACE,KFORC,LAYER1,LAYER2,KYNDIV
我设定了ndiv(或者size,此时nidiv=line_length/size)和space,然后就划分。线段就被划分为ndiv段,其中第一段长度a,最后一段长度b。现在我的问题是,要指定第一段的长度a,请问怎么实现?
我看到有人说线段的长度是个等比数列,然后自己计算了一下,发现如果是等比数列b=a*q^(n-1),n的值不确定,还需要知道等比的值。
有什么办法设置ndiv和space使得我的第一条线段是自己想要的长度a啊!
现在还只是手调,很烦···想问的是怎么设n来得到自己想要的长度a,可能我没说明白。现在划分线段,开始的第一段的长度我指定要是a,但是lesize里没法设这个参数,只能设ndiv(或size)和spacing ratio。怎么合理设置这两个值让开始的第一段的长度我指定要是a?
可以列的方程:
a*q^(n-1)=space*a → q^(n-1)=space 【等比数列】
L=(a-a*q^n)/(1-q) 【等比数列求和及线段总长度】
两个方程,三个未知量,space,q和n。第一段的长度a(我要设的)和直线总长度L都是确定的。ansys是怎么设置的q的,这个我不知道····如果知道q那space和n就好弄了。我用的是盗版的ansys,没有相关服务,如果有哪位在用正版的可以问一下技术支持吗?
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

智能机器人

Robot (super robot)

我们都爱小木虫

找到一些相关的精华帖子,希望有用哦~

科研从小木虫开始,人人为我,我为人人
相关版块跳转 我要订阅楼主 zhuce9 的主题更新
信息提示
请填处理意见